What Google Cloud Platform training path should I do?

If you’re new to the cloud, your path to GCP certification begins with the foundational-level Cloud Digital Leader certification, which requires no tech experience. If you have some cloud experience, you can start with the Associate Cloud Engineer to pick up the basics of GCP.

Then explore skills that align with your career goals. Interested in AI? Take a deep dive into Google Cloud AI services. Want to strengthen your security chops? Study up on the essentials of Google Cloud security. As your skills grow, take aim at one of the professional-level GCP certifications, like the Google Cloud Certified Professional Cloud Security Engineer or the popular Google Certified Professional Cloud Architect.

Why train for Google Cloud certification?

A cloud certification is validation that you possess a certain set of knowledge and skills. While it’s the skills that truly matter, a GCP certification can be a valuable signifier to employers or clients and help you secure a satisfying and well-paying cloud career. 

GCP certification exams aren’t easy. But Pluralsight Skills can help you get certified and advance your career in Google Cloud. Google Cloud is growing—and so is the demand for talent with GCP skills. How much so? The Google Certified Professional Cloud Architect has been named the top-paying cloud certification for years in a row, pulling in an average salary of USD$175,000.
